one more to add today - 1913-S Type 2 Buffalo nickel(with almost 1.3 million minted).
This completes all 6 coins for the first year issue.
This coin is uncirculated so I put it in a low to mid MS Grade. I'm not seeing any kind of contact hits or dings on it.
I picked this coin because it is in great shape, and has a very nice die clash showing on both sides.
